Game Overview

NHL 2002 for the Game Boy Advance came out in 2001, published by EA Sports. It was one of the few hockey titles on the handheld, arriving early in the system's life when sports games were still figuring out how to translate the console experience to a smaller screen. The game tried to bring a full NHL season, playoffs, and even a shootout mode into your hands, which felt ambitious at the time.

You control a team of five skaters and a goalie, working to outscore the opponent in fast, arcade-style matches. The main objective is to win games across various modes, from exhibition matches to a full season. Signature mechanics include one-timer shots, which require precise timing to pull off, and a card collection system where you earn power-ups to temporarily boost player attributes like speed or shot accuracy. The pacing is quick, with short periods that keep things moving, though the AI can be punishing on higher difficulties. It feels like a stripped-down but surprisingly functional version of hockey that fits in your pocket.
